diff --git a/client/src/components/document/DocumentUpload.tsx b/client/src/components/document/DocumentUpload.tsx index 2994992..1eebc29 100644 --- a/client/src/components/document/DocumentUpload.tsx +++ b/client/src/components/document/DocumentUpload.tsx @@ -1,15 +1,10 @@ -import React, { useState } from 'react'; -import { - Box, - Button, - CircularProgress, - Alert -} from '@mui/material'; import { CloudUpload as CloudUploadIcon } from '@mui/icons-material'; -import { documentApi } from '../../api/client'; -import { DocumentType } from '../../types/document'; -import { ApiError } from '../../types/api'; +import { Alert, Box, Button, CircularProgress } from '@mui/material'; import { AxiosError } from 'axios'; +import React, { useState } from 'react'; +import { documentApi } from '../../api/client'; +import { ApiError } from '../../types/api'; +import { DocumentType } from '../../types/document'; interface DocumentUploadProps { onUploadSuccess: (documentId: string) => void; @@ -41,7 +36,7 @@ export const DocumentUpload = ({ onUploadSuccess, documentType, label }: Documen if (err instanceof AxiosError && err.response?.data) { const apiError = err.response.data as ApiError; const messages = Array.isArray(apiError.message) - ? apiError.message.map(m => `${m.field}: ${m.message}`).join('\n') + ? apiError.message.map((m) => `${m.field}: ${m.message}`).join('\n') : apiError.message; setError(messages); } else { @@ -52,17 +47,18 @@ export const DocumentUpload = ({ onUploadSuccess, documentType, label }: Documen } }; + const now = new Date(); return ( -